developing State-Level AI Regulation: Navigating a Patchwork Landscape
The sector of artificial intelligence (AI) is evolving at a rapid pace, prompting governments worldwide to grapple with its implications. Throughout the United States, states are taking the step in crafting AI regulations, resulting in a fragmented patchwork of laws. This landscape presents both opportunities and challenges for businesses operating in the AI space.
One of the primary advantages of state-level regulation is its capacity to promote innovation while tackling potential risks. By testing different approaches, states can discover best practices that can then be utilized at the federal level. However, this distributed approach can also create ambiguity for businesses that must comply with a diverse of requirements.
Navigating this patchwork landscape demands careful evaluation and strategic planning. Businesses must keep abreast of emerging state-level developments and adjust their practices accordingly. Furthermore, they should participate themselves in the regulatory process to influence to the development of a consistent national framework for AI regulation.

Tackling Defects in Intelligent Systems
As artificial intelligence becomes integrated into products across diverse industries, the legal framework surrounding product liability must evolve to accommodate the unique challenges posed by intelligent systems. Unlike traditional products with defined functionalities, AI-powered gadgets often possess complex algorithms that can shift their behavior based on user interaction. This inherent intricacy makes it challenging to identify and attribute defects, raising critical questions about liability when AI systems malfunction.
Moreover, the constantly evolving nature of AI systems presents a substantial hurdle in establishing a thorough legal framework. Existing product liability laws, often created for fixed products, may prove inadequate in addressing the unique traits of intelligent systems.
As a result, it is essential to develop new legal paradigms that can effectively mitigate the challenges associated with AI product liability. This will require cooperation among lawmakers, industry stakeholders, and legal experts to establish a regulatory landscape that encourages innovation while ensuring consumer well-being.
